About 3 Williams Grove
3 Williams Grove is a semi-detached house in Crowle, Worcester, Worcester (WR7 4SD). It has a recorded floor area of 80 m² (around 861 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1991-1995 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(July 2022) shows an E (score 52),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 76),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ity.
On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ement.
